ALL CRANE & EQUIPMENT RENTAL CORP

ALL CRANE & EQUIPMENT RENTAL CORP is a mid-sized fleet, operating 37 power units and 40 drivers, organized as a corporation, based in Nitro, WV. Across 40 roadside inspections in the last 24 months, the fleet's 17.5% out-of-service rate sits near the 19.4% national average, with 1 reportable crash. BMC-91 liability filing is on file with NATIONAL INTERSTATE INSURANCE COMPANY, and operating authority is active for common.

Active liability insurance
FMCSA cargo filing (BMC-34/83)

FMCSA L&I filing evidence — not a shipper certificate of insurance (COI). Cargo (BMC-34) is primarily an HHG / household-goods requirement; general freight carriers often have none.

Broker bond / trust (BMC-84/85)

No active broker surety bond or trust fund on file.

BMC-84 is a surety bond; BMC-85 is a trust-fund agreement. Required for property brokers / freight forwarders — not motor-carrier BIPD liability insurance.
